## Approvals: Tide-Table Widget

Changes to the Saltgrove tide-table widget require approval before merge. The widget pulls predictions from the Moonwake service; any change to its polling interval or cache TTL is considered high-risk. Reviewers: check the offline fallback renders correctly and that daylight-saving offsets are untouched. Final sign-off on all tide-table changes rests with one person.

named custodian: Brivan Eliath Quenox Frador

Subject: Key rotation — autocomplete index service

Team, as part of the investigation into slow autocomplete on Quillbrook search, we rotated the credential for the suggestion-index service while re-sharding it. Old keys stop working Friday at noon. Latency should drop once the warm cache rebuilds; expect intermittent slowness until then, and tag related tickets with AUTOSLOW. Support tooling that queries the index directly must switch to the rotated key, which appears below.

gateway credential: kto3_qfe

TICKET-2218: Drift detected on Inkrelay printer-spooler microservice between canary and fleet. Canary got the new retry/backoff knobs from last sprint; fleet nodes still carry the January baseline plus two manual hotfix edits nobody recorded. Spool queues on drifted nodes stall under burst load. Blocking Thursday's release until reconciled — release manager, please approve pinning fleet to the canary set. For reference, the intended spooler configuration after reconciliation is listed below.

config for kafof-bawef:
holath:
  log_level: debug
  metrics_host: metrics.holath.qorvelsys.internal
  pin: 2191
  pool_size: 32

# Break-Glass Access — Sproutly Scheduler

Sproutly, our plant-watering scheduler, normally requires two-party approval for production changes. In an emergency (e.g., valves stuck open and flooding the greenhouse test rig), break-glass access bypasses approval. Reviewers: break-glass commits must still be retroactively reviewed within 24 hours and logged in the incident tracker. To activate break-glass mode, run the emergency unlock script from the ops bastion and enter the recovery passphrase that follows.

vault phrase of tajeg-tageg = pelix-druix-holius-briael-zorwyn-frawyn-fraox-norok-drueth-aldiel